Vintage Bird Illustration

This black and white bird illustration is from the book "Useful birds and their protection. Containing brief descriptions of the more common and useful species of Massachusetts, with accounts of their food habits, and a chapter on the means of attracting and protecting birds" by Edward Forbush.
An extremely verbose title for a book! It was published in 1913.

Lydia Pinkham Trade Card

This pretty trade card advertised Lydia Estes Pinkham's (February 9, 1819 – May 17, 1883) famous women's tonic. Some thought it was quack medicine, but a few of the ingredients are still used today. It also contained a lot of alcohol, which probably helped more than anything!
The tonic contained Butterfly weed, Black Cohosh, Golden Ragwort (not ragweed), and Fenugreek - all of these have anti-inflammatory properties, and Black Cohosh is still used for menopausal issues.
